Nuclear Medicine Tech – Full Time
About the role
Jackson HealthPros is seeking an experienced nuclear med tech for a permanent role with an area healthcare client where you’ll work collaboratively with a multi-disciplinary team and be responsible for preparing and administering radioactive drugs and operate radiation detection and imaging equipment.
Requirements
- An associate or bachelor’s degree in nuclear medicine technology
- ARRT(N) and/or NMTCB certification
- State Nuclear Medicine License for Virginia
- Venipuncture certification/permit
- BLS certification
- At least one year of diagnostic imaging or nuclear medicine experience preferred
- Availability to work days, Monday–Friday, 9:00am–5:30pm
